Golden Guitar-winning Australian singer-songwriter, Amber Lawrence will bring her tour to town in July as part of the Live Music Lake Mac series.
Amber’s live shows are nothing short of uplifting. Her songs about self-belief, fun, family and ordinary Australians have captured the hearts of country music fans across the nation for over 20 years.
In 2023 Amber was named the Female Artist of the Year at the CMAA Golden Guitar Awards and she was inducted into the prestigious Galaxy of Stars alongside legends such as Kasey Chambers and Lee Kernaghan.

Over 7 studio albums the Australian country music sensation has produced a remarkable body of work that has earned her fans across generations.
One of the keys to her success is relentless a touring schedule. in 2022, Amber took to the stage for over 90 shows across the country.
Supporting Amber on the local leg of her tour is local artist, Piper Rodrigues.
Piper is no stranger to the supporting role of Australian country greats. She’s opened for artists like Hayley Jensen and Catherine Britt, and takes her influence from powerhouse artists like Taylor Swift, Kelsea Ballerini, Brandi Carlile and Dolly Parton.
The Live Music Lake Mac series show is part of Amber’s national tour celebrating the 1 year anniversary of her award-winning album Living for the Highlights.
